Conventional Waterproofing Approaches
Standard waterproofing methods have actually been used for centuries, counting on reliable techniques and materials to protect frameworks from water damage. One of the earliest methods includes using clay, which, when compacted, produces an all-natural barrier versus moisture. Furthermore, bitumen, a sticky, black product acquired from oil, has been utilized for its water-resistant residential or commercial properties, commonly used to roofing systems and foundations.Another strategy involves the application of lime-based plasters, which provide a breathable layer that enables wetness to escape while stopping water access. Thatch roofing, a typical technique still seen in some societies, uses superb waterproofing as a result of its securely packed straw layers.Moreover, making use of stone and block has projected, as these products are inherently immune to water when properly mounted. Generally, traditional waterproofing methods stress the value of picking proper materials and building and construction methods to boost durability versus water breach.

Materials Used in Waterproofing
The performance of waterproofing services heavily depends on the materials utilized in their application. Different materials are employed to develop obstacles against water access, each with unique residential properties suited for different settings. Frequently used products include membranes, coatings, and sealants.Liquid-applied membrane layers, usually made from polyurethane or acrylic, develop a smooth obstacle that adjusts to complicated surfaces. Sheet membranes, commonly built from rubber or thermoplastic, deal toughness and are perfect for larger areas. Additionally, cementitious waterproofing materials, made up of cementitious substances, supply outstanding attachment and flexibility.Sealants made from silicone or polyurethane are vital for joints and joints, guaranteeing comprehensive defense. Advanced materials, such as geo-composite membrane layers, incorporate numerous features, boosting performance. Generally, the selection of waterproofing products is crucial in attaining long-lasting and effective water resistance, customized to specific job requirements and environmental conditions.

Residential Waterproofing Solutions
Several homeowners deal with challenges with wetness intrusion, making reliable domestic waterproofing options vital. Numerous approaches exist to resolve this issue, consisting of inside and outside waterproofing systems. Interior options typically include the application of sealers and finishings to cellar walls, which assist avoid water infiltration. Outside techniques typically consist of the installment of water drainage systems and water resistant membranes that divert water far from the foundation.Additionally, property owners may take into consideration sump pumps to eliminate water accumulation and dehumidifiers to control humidity degrees. Correct grading and using seamless gutters also play an important role in handling water circulation around the home. By applying these methods, home owners can greatly decrease the risk of water damages and mold growth, guaranteeing a completely dry and safe living atmosphere.

Can Waterproofing Be Applied in Cold Climate?
The inquiry of using waterproofing in winter increases problems regarding adhesion and healing. Numerous products may not execute at their best in low temperatures, requiring cautious option and factor to consider of certain guidelines for reliable application.
How Much Time Does Waterproofing Usually Last?
The duration of waterproofing effectiveness varies based on materials and environmental factors. Usually, it can last from 5 to ten years, yet regular maintenance and examinations are essential to ensure peak performance and longevity.
